Pricing and Cost Advice
  • "The product is a bit expensive considering the competition but the company may negotiate the price."
  • "This is an expensive solution."
  • "The solution's pricing is competitive. I rate the solution's pricing a seven out of ten. The price of the solution could be cheaper."
  • "Splunk has been fairly expensive, but it has been predictable."
  • "I would rate the price of Splunk Infrastructure Monitoring as an eight out of ten, with ten being the most expensive."
  • "I am not in that circle, but we are currently licensing based on our queries. That is working out for us. Previously, it was by volume of data, and now, we can store as much data as we want."
  • "It is expensive."
  • "Splunk's infrastructure monitoring costs can be high because our billing is based on data volume measured in terabytes, rather than the number of devices being monitored."

    Overview

    Splunk Infrastructure Monitoring offers features including, Instant visualization, real-time actionable alerts, centralized enterprise controls, and scalability. 

    Instant visualization

    Get fast time to value with over 250+ cloud service integrations and pre-built dashboards out of the box for rapid, full-stack visualization. Autodiscover, break down, group, and explore clouds, services and systems in minutes.

    Real-time actionable alerts

    Act before infrastructure performance affects end-user experience. Instantly detect and accurately alerts on dynamic thresholds, multiple conditions and complex rules to eliminate alert storms and dramatically reduce MTTD/MTTR.

    Centralized, enterprise controls

    Answer business-critical questions in context and monitor service-level objectives and indicators instantly. Track custom metrics for business KPIs to token based access and usage controls.

    Scale with confidence

    Troubleshoot across thousands of microservices, multiple ephemeral deployments, application versions and billions of events. Release better apps faster and drive closed-loop automation for a flawless end-user experience.

    Splunk IT Service Intelligence (ITSI) is a powerful analytics-driven monitoring and analytics solution that provides real-time insights into the health and performance of IT services. 

    It enables organizations to proactively identify and resolve issues, optimize service delivery, and improve overall IT operations. With its advanced machine learning capabilities, ITSI automatically detects anomalies, predicts future events, and prioritizes alerts based on business impact. 

    The solution offers a centralized view of IT services, allowing users to visualize and analyze data from multiple sources in a single dashboard. ITSI also provides customizable KPIs, service-level agreements (SLAs), and key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ure and track service performance. 

    With its intuitive interface and powerful analytics capabilities, Splunk ITSI empowers IT teams to deliver reliable and efficient services, ensuring maximum uptime and customer satisfaction.
